Tel: 04 67 04 75 00. 34 Péret: What's On Art & Exhibitions Pierre Callon sculpture interventions at Private Views/Vernissages From: Thursday 20 August 2009 To: Saturday 19 December 2009 Always a sculptor in his soul, Pierre works with many materials including, wood, stone, metal and ice. He first exhibited in 19985 at Tarbes (65) and since then his work has taken him towards the more ephemeral: Land Art, sculptures in snow, ice and sand. He still continues to work in wood and other traditional sculptural materials. He has been living and working in the region since 1999, and was a member of the artists collective ‘La Grande Barge’ in Villeneuve-lès-Maguelone until the opening in December 2005 of his own gallery, ‘L'Atelier du Nord’ in the Figuerolles quarter of Montpellier. For information gabbycampbell.anpq@neuf.fr or Tel: 04 67 44 79 86 Zoe Benbow: Wild Path From: Saturday 3 October 2009 To: Saturday 7 November 2009 Exhibition of paintings by Zoe Benbow who is a full time professional painter living and working in London and the Tarn Valley. Zoe Benbow's new work is based in landscape, an abstract geological landscape developed from direct experience in a remote environment. The paintings are evolved from drawings made in situ, yet are as much a meditation on the geology of association and memory as of actual place.
